- Reliability (3)While generally decent, some owners have reported issues with the DSG transmission and turbocharger over time. Regular maintenance is key to ensuring longevity.
- Maintenance (3)Routine maintenance is on par with other German sedans. Parts can be moderately expensive, and finding specialized mechanics might be necessary for complex repairs.
- Technology (3)The infotainment system is functional but feels a bit dated compared to newer rivals. Bluetooth connectivity and basic features are present, but advanced driver aids are limited on this trim.
- Comfort (4)Seats are supportive and comfortable for long journeys. The cabin is generally quiet, though road noise can be noticeable on coarser surfaces. Rear-seat headroom is a bit compromised by the sloping roofline.
- Dynamics (4)The 2.0T engine offers a good balance of power and efficiency, making it enjoyable for daily driving and spirited sprints. The Sport trim provides a slightly firmer suspension for better handling.
